They say there was a spark of magic that hit that forest.
Animals who were previously content just eating and wandering around suddenly desired an education, homes, and money. Soon, animals were communicating with humans, dressing in human clothes and other than the obvious physical differences, were human.
A lot of humans were pleasantly surprised when their beloved pet was able to convey their love for their partner. A select few humans however got a piece of their pet's mind. Let's just say shock collars and tiny sweaters were no longer sold in their village.
Other humans were uncomfortable with the change. Talking animals meant animals demanding to be treated as equals. Animals having jobs makes it harder for humans to get hired. Who would hire a human security guard when you could have a bear?
It wasn't entirely approved of by the animals either. Cows weren't just going to pretend that they haven't been raised just for food. The animals who weren't being eaten weren't happy their offspring were going to school with human kids, and when young people are in the same place, they start developing feelings for each other. Neither group wanted their child to end up with another species, so something must be done.
A council was formed to iron out the issues between the two groups.
The decision was unanimous.
The animals are to leave and create their own village.
Pet partners were devastated. Imagine explaining to your family that someone who was basically a member has to leave forever. That's not to say that there was no communication between the villages, in fact, there was a lot of business between the two.
A few animals wanted more than just the village, and wandered all of Gaia for a place where they could fit in. Some found jobs in places like Barton and Durem. Most, however, settled into the Pawlands.
That was over 200 years ago.
